About the Role:
We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Payroll Specialist to join our dynamic finance team. In this role, you will oversee the timely and accurate processing of monthly payroll for circa 450 employees across various divisions. You will be responsible for ensuring compliance with UK tax legislation and company policies to accurately process the monthly payroll. You will also manage holiday allowances, pension schemes, and provide exceptional support to employees regarding payroll-related enquiries.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Payroll Processing: Oversee monthly payroll for all employees, including starters, leavers, and changes within the pay period. Ensure accurate calculation and processing of variable payments and deductions (e.g., bonuses, overtime, allowances).
2. Pension and Benefits Management: Manage payrolling on benefits in kind and accurately manage the pay variable payments for all employees. You will also ensure accurate Group Personal Pension scheme calculations and monthly payments to the pension provider. Manage pension re-enrolment in line with UK auto-enrolment legislation.
3. Holiday Management: Manage holiday software (Leave Dates), ensuring correct allowances for new starters and accrued holiday payments for leavers.
4. Compliance and Reporting: Ensure compliance with UK tax legislation, prepare and submit tax information to HMRC, and collaborate in internal and external audits of payroll processes.
5. System and Process Improvements: Identify opportunities to streamline and improve payroll processes, maintaining payroll systems and software.
6. Employee Support: Respond to payroll-related enquiries from employees, handling confidential information with discretion.
7. Audit and Reconciliation: Conduct periodic audits to ensure payroll data accuracy, reconcile payroll data with general ledger accounts, and maintain organised payroll files for compliance and auditing purposes.
Minimum Requirements:
* Minimum of 5 years’ experience in payroll processing.
* Experience with multi-departmental payroll processing for a workforce of over 450+ employees.
* Proficiency in payroll software, specifically Sage 50 Payroll.
